3D Developer - JavaScript and Babylon.js (Full remote)
Seeking 3D Developer (Babylon.js/JavaScript) to optimize performance, integrate assets, solve rendering issues. Mandatory: English C1. Skills with other 3D frameworks are also desired. Join our team!
Job Description:
We are seeking a talented and passionate 3D Developer to join our innovative team. The ideal candidate will have a strong background in web-based 3D graphics development, with extensive experience in JavaScript and the Babylon.js framework. He will be responsible for designing, developing, and optimizing immersive and interactive 3D editor for our web application. This role offers the opportunity to work on cutting-edge projects and collaborate with a dynamic team of engineers. It requires English level C1 at least.
Responsabilities:
- Develop, implement, and maintain high-quality, performant 3D applications and experiences using Babylon.js and JavaScript.
- Collaborate with designers and artists to integrate 3D models, textures, animations, and other assets into web applications.
- Optimize 3D scenes and assets for efficient rendering and smooth performance across various devices and browsers (desktop and mobile).
- Implement interactive features, user interfaces, and animations within 3D environments to enhance user engagement.
- Troubleshoot and resolve technical issues related to 3D rendering, graphics, and performance bottlenecks.
- Participate in code reviews, contribute to technical discussions, and maintain clean, well-documented code.
- (Optional, if applicable) Integrate 3D experiences with backend systems and APIs.
Skills & Qualifications:
- Strong proficiency in JavaScript (ES6+).
- Extensive hands-on experience with Babylon.js, including scene setup, object manipulation, lighting, materials, and animations.
- Solid understanding of 3D graphics concepts, including vectors, transformations, matrices, shaders (GLSL), and the graphics pipeline.
- Experience with WebGL-based 3D development.
- Familiarity with importing and optimizing 3D assets (e.g., GLTF/GLB, Blender, 3ds Max, Maya).
- Knowledge of performance optimization techniques for web 3D applications (e.g., LOD, frustum culling, texture management).
- Experience with version control systems (e.g., Git).
- Strong debugging and problem-solving skills.
- Excellent communication and collaboration skills.
- English level: C1
Bonus skills (highly Desired):
- Experience with React.js (or other modern JavaScript frameworks like Vue.js or Angular) for building user interfaces and integrating with 3D scenes.
- Familiarity with TypeScript.
- Experience with other 3D frameworks (e.g., Three.js, PlayCanvas).
- Knowledge of 3D modeling software (e.g., Blender).
Skills Summary:
- JavaScript – high
- React – high
- TypeScript – medium
- SDLC – Medium
- Digital Twins – High
Company:
Being part of THEWHITEAM means collaborating with a company made up of professionals with extensive experience in technology consulting.
We firmly believe that businesses and clients set the direction for the sector, but it is people who build it. We consider it vitally important that our organization is founded on our greatest asset and value-added hallmark: our human team.
Additional Benefits:
Additionally, here's a brief summary of company policies so you can get to know us a little better:
- Our collective agreement falls under Consulting Firms and Market Research.
- We offer 23 vacation days per year.
- We have 14 paychecks per year (12 monthly payments + 2 extra payments in June and December).
- As flexible compensation, we can request childcare vouchers and health + dental insurance.
- Departamento
- IT
- Puesto
- CONSULTOR/A
- Estado remoto
- Completamente remoto
Bilbao
¿Qué ofrecemos?
-
Horarios
TheWhiteam ofrece horarios flexibles. Esto se debe a que buscamos cumplir objetivos, no llegar a una cantidad de horas.
-
Tecnologias
Las tecnologías más punteras, para estar actualizados a los cambios del momento.
-
Modalidad de Trabajo
Dada la situación TheWhiteam da la posibilidad de una modalidad de trabajo presencial, teletrabajo o mixta.
-
Ubicaciones
TheWhiteam da la posibilidad de trabajar en ubicaciones situadas por todo el mundo.
Lugar de trabajo
Formar parte de THEWHITEAM es colaborar con una empresa formada por profesionales con una dilatada experiencia en consultoría tecnológica.
Creemos firmemente que las empresas y clientes marcan el camino a seguir en el sector, pero éste lo construyen las personas. Consideramos de vital importancia que nuestra organización se fundamente en nuestro mejor activo y marca de valor añadido que es nuestro equipo humano.
Acerca de The White Team
Fundada en 2012 por consultores experimentados The Whiteam nace como consultora tecnológica de calidad con una misión clara; ayudar a las compañías de todo el mundo a optimizar su rentabilidad empresarial a través de un uso eficiente de las tecnologías de la información.
¿Ya trabajas en The White Team?
Ayúdanos a encontrar a tu próximo compañero/a.